Would it be possible to make the path to the docker executable editable for your docker based build environment?

 

At the moment, the command in your makefile configuration files (inside the bricklib2/cmake folder) include the static path, that is /usr/bin/docker. On a mac, for instance, docker doesn't install into /usr/bin though.

 

It would be possible for me to change all these occurrences, that's not the question. However, I don't want to change that many files, given that I don't want conflicts in the cloned git repository.

I just replaced "/usr/bin/docker" with "docker" for now (we were using "docker" at other places in the Makefile anyway).

 

If the docker binary is not somewhere in $PATH you can always call make with PATH=$PATH:/your/path to make it work.
